Output 76e08414623a82334582798e95c8e49bb6181b974f2197097678e14bd0909602:6

value
31107
script pubkey
OP_0 OP_PUSHBYTES_20 3d5eea4666f96cfe1932182eea3498d8f9af08fc
address
bc1q840w53nxl9k0uxfjrqhw5dycmru67z8u37k7fv
transaction
76e08414623a82334582798e95c8e49bb6181b974f2197097678e14bd0909602
spent
true